  • Hi @clayslinger  :D If you purchased the seeds, you'll have the package of seeds in your inventory. Drag it into the world from your inventory and click open. The seeds from the package will again appear in your inventory. Drag them onto soil, or onto a garden box and click plant. What I recently learned is that if a garden box has multiple seeds you want to plant, you only have to give the plant command once and your sim will continue to plant all nearby seeds! What's also fun is harvesting flowers, herbs, fruits from nearby bushes/trees. The harvested product shows in your inventory and you can again drag it onto a garden box to plant your own. In that case, no need to purchase seeds 🙂 One more thing on this topic: during harvest fest, some gnomes will appear around your house. If you can please the gnomes well, they give you some gifts and in my experience they were always giving various very nice seed packages. Enjoy the gardening 🙂

  • @clayslingerIt's easy. Once you open the packet, you'll have various food or flowers in your inventory.

    If you are outside, just place it on the ground (dirt or grass, not a tile) You can also use a planter to plant indoors or outdoors. Although Trees require some room.

    Just drag like an onion onto the ground or a planter and click on it while it's on the ground. You should get the option to "Plant". Click on that and you're done.

    Just make sure to Water it!
